Pork Collar Recipe with Mashed Potatoes | olivemagazine
Richard Corrigan's recipe is a spin on the classic Irish dish that traditionally uses bacon – in this case it’s cured pork collar
Ingredients
- 1 onion roughly chopped
- 1 carrot roughly chopped
- 2 sprigs thyme
- 4 bay leaves
- 1 tsp black peppercorns
- 1 kg cured collar of pork
- 150ml white wine vinegar
- 50g caster sugar
- 1 shallot cut into rings
- a handful flat-leaf parsley finely chopped
- 6 white onions thinly sliced
- 100g unsalted butter
- 75ml double cream
- (such as Maris Piper) 1kg floury potatoes peeled and chopped
- 150g butter
- 50ml whole milk
